101. Solving a chemistry problem

Find the heat carried away by the flue gas at atmospheric pressure, if the composition of its components in volume percent is known, the total volume of gas, the flue gas temperature at the exit of the furnace t1 and the ambient temperature t2, molar heat capacities (J / (mol-k) of flue gas components within the specified temperatures are equal:
СP,CO2=44.44 9.04*10-3T – 8.53*105T-2
СP,CO=28.41 4.10*10-3T – 0.46*105T-2
СP,O2=31.46 3.39*10-3T – 3.77*105T-2
СP,N2=27.87 4.27*10-3T.
Take the number of your option from the table. one

N option Flue gas composition in volume percent Gas volume, m3 t1.0C t2.0C
CO2 CO O2 N2
7 8 5 9 78 16 200 17
